Solar Energy, Battery Storage Projects For Estonia

Sunly, in collaboration with Metsagrupp, is developing a 16 MW / 32 MWh battery energy storage system (BESS) next to the 45 MW Raba Solar Park in Pärnu County, Estonia. Coalition reaches deal on wind energy reverse auctions, energy storage

The leaders of Estonia''s three coalition parties have agreed to organize reverse auctions for 2 terawatt-hours (TWh) of production each for offshore and onshore wind farms. The government is also planning a support measure for an energy storage facility in Paldiski.

Estonia''s first energy storage project gets green light for

Estonia''s first large-scale energy storage project, Zero Terrain, has received an official permit and construction can go ahead. Developed by Energiasalv, the 550 MW underground pumped-hydro storage plant has minor environmental and land-use impact and can therefore be implemented in urban areas. Premises

The Estonian power system consists of oil shale fired power plants in North-East Estonia, a combined heat and power plant near Tallinn, wind parks, and hydro plants. Since February 9th 2025, Estonia, Latvia and Lithuania have successfully synchronised with the Continental European electricity grid.

EU Approves €2.6bn Estonian Aid for Offshore Wind

Wedoany Report-Dec 11,The European Commission has approved a €2.6 billion Estonian scheme to support renewable offshore wind energy to foster the transition towards a net-zero economy. The measure will support the construction and operation of offshore wind farms for electricity production in the areas determined by the Estonian Maritime Spatial Plan.

French Developer Wins Estonian Offshore Auction

Wedoany Report-Jan 24, Oxan Energy has secured permission to build an offshore wind farm in Estonian waters following a re-run auction. The Consumer Protection and Technical Regulatory Authority (CPTRA) announced that the French developer is the winner of the auction for the Saare 1 area.

How much does electricity cost in Estonia?

Estonia, June 2023: The price of electricity is 0.320 U.S. Dollar per kWh for households and 0.183 U.S. Dollar for businesses which includes all components of the electricity bill such as the cost of power, distribution and taxes.

How much energy does Estonia use?

Estonia's all-time peak consumption is 1591 MW (in 2021). In 2021 the electricity generated from renewable energy sources was 29.3 %, being 38% of the share of renewable energy in gross final energy consumption. Oil-based fuels, including oil shale and fuel oils, accounted for about 80% of domestic production in 2016.

Does the Freen home energy storage system work with small wind turbines?

The Freen Home Energy Storage System is designed to work seamlessly with the company’s signature small wind turbines. Freen is renowned for its Darrieus-type vertical small wind turbines, featuring soft blade designs with near-frictionless architecture, low noise emissions, and strong performance.

What is a residential energy storage system?

The residential energy storage system comes with a rated voltage of 48V, and an operating voltage range from 40V to 60V. It achieves a depth of discharge of 90%. Its maximum charge/discharge rate is 210A. The battery delivers more 4,000 charge-discharge cycles.
